How to Apply for The Bahamas Travel Health Visa

  1. Create a Profile. To apply for your Travel Health Visa, first you’ll need to create a profile.
  2. Add a Trip. After your profile is created, you’ll need to add a trip with travel details and RT-PCR test results or Vaccination Card.*
  3. Get Approved.
  4. Take your Trip.

How do I get a visa for The Bahamas?

Submit the completed Bahamian Visa Application form along with supporting documentation. All applicants must appear in person at the nearest Bahamas Consulate or Embassy. See www.mfabahamas.org for address and contact information of Bahamas Missions.

Do you need a travel visa for Bahamas?

U.S. citizens are generally required to present a valid U.S. passport when traveling to The Bahamas, as well as proof of anticipated departure from The Bahamas. U.S. travelers coming for tourism will not need a visa for travel up to 90 days. All other travelers will need a visa and/or work permit.

How much is travel visa to Bahamas?

Cost of The Bahamas Health Travel Visa: $40 – Citizens and returning residents. $60 – Visitors staying more than four nights.

Who needs visa for Bahamas?

A valid national passport and a Bahamas visa are required for U.S. resident non-citizens wishing to stay longer than 30 days. Canadian visitors only require a visa if stays exceed more than eight (8) months.

How long can a US citizen stay in the Bahamas?

An American national may stay for a maximum period of eight months without a visa in The Bahamas. Should they wish to extend their stay, application must be made to the Immigration Department for an extension of stay.

Is Bahamas part of USA?

The Bahamas achieved independence from Britain July 10, 1973, and is now a fully self-governing member of the Commonwealth and a member of the United Nations, the Caribbean Community and the Organisation of American States.

Do green card holders need visa for Bahamas?

Green card holders do not require visas to visit The Bahamas. A valid passport for six months from the date of leaving The Bahamas.

How much does a travel visa cost?

The application fee for the most common nonimmigrant visa types is US$160. This includes tourist, business, student, and exchange visas. Most petition-based visas, such as work and religious visas, are US$190. K visas cost US$265 and the fee amount for E visas is US$205.
